Tại sao nên học Ruby – Ngôn ngữ lập trình hấp dẫn

Bước vào thế giới lập trình, bạn có thể băn khoăn về việc chọn ngôn ngữ phù hợp để bắt đầu hành trình sáng tạo. Có nhiều sự lựa chọn & mỗi ngôn ngữ đều có ưu điểm riêng. Vậy làm sao để quyết định & tìm ra ngôn ngữ lập trình thích hợp cho mình?

Nếu bạn đang tìm kiếm một ngôn ngữ dễ học, linh hoạt & mạnh mẽ, thì Rubi có thể là lựa chọn hoàn hảo. Được tạo ra với mục tiêu tối giản cú pháp & tập trung vào sự đơn giản, Ruby dễ dàng tiếp cận cho người mới bắt đầu, nhưng vẫn cung cấp sức mạnh cho các developer chuyên nghiệp.

Với Ruby, bạn có thể tập trung vào việc tạo ra các ứng dụng web động, dễ dàng kết hợp với các framework phổ biến như Rubi on Rails. Ngoài ra, Ruby cũng hỗ trợ lập trình hướng đối tượng, giúp bạn xây dựng mã nguồn dễ bảo trì & mở rộng. Sự đa dạng & mạnh mẽ của thư viện Rubi cũng giúp bạn giải quyết các vấn đề phức tạp một cách hiệu quả.

Tại sao nên học Ruby - Ngôn ngữ lập trình hấp dẫn

Ngôn Ngữ Lập Trình Ruby – Tính Năng & Ưu Việt

Định Nghĩa & Khởi Nguyên

Rubi là một trong những ngôn ngữ lập trình hướng đối tượng phổ biến, được sử dụng rộng rãi trong phát triển ứng dụng web & di động. Được sáng tạo bởi Yukihiro vào năm 1993, ngôn ngữ này vẫn tiếp tục phát triển mạnh mẽ cho đến ngày nay.

Lời Chuyên Gia – Ruby & Tính Tự Do

Theo Robert Armstrong, giám đốc điều hành của Appstem, Rubi là một trong những ngôn ngữ tuyệt vời mà developer mới nào cũng nên học. Ruby được thiết kế để tương tác gần gũi với con người, chứ không chỉ đơn thuần dựa vào máy móc. Điều này giúp hoàn thành công việc nhanh hơn so với các ngôn ngữ khác.

Đặc Điểm Nổi Bật Của Ruby

  • Lập trình hướng đối tượng: Rubi cho phép bạn tập hợp data & method thành một đối tượng & kết hợp chúng để lập trình hiệu quả.
  • Linh hoạt & đa dạng: Ruby tự hào về các framework & thư viện phong phú, giúp bạn xây dựng các ứng dụng đa dạng & linh hoạt.
  • Cú pháp tự do: Rubi được đánh giá cao vì cú pháp tự do, giúp bạn phát triển và chỉnh sửa chương trình một cách dễ dàng.
  • Giải thích interpreter: Ruby cho phép bạn mô tả và chạy chương trình trực tiếp, giúp phát hiện và sửa lỗi một cách hiệu quả.
  • Tối giản hóa kiểu dữ liệu: Rubi không yêu cầu tạo kiểu dữ liệu biến, giúp giảm phần nội dung mô tả và làm cho ngôn ngữ dễ diễn tả hơn.

Ruby là công cụ lý tưởng để bắt đầu và khám phá sức mạnh lập trình.

Tại sao nên học Ruby - Ngôn ngữ lập trình hấp dẫn

Ưu Điểm và Nhược Điểm Của Ngôn Ngữ Lập Trình Ruby

Ưu Điểm Nổi Bật

  1. Dễ học và sử dụng: Rubi là ngôn ngữ lập trình vô cùng dễ học, cho phép bạn dễ dàng tiếp cận và làm chủ. Nếu bạn thành thạo Ruby, việc sử dụng Ruby on Rails trở nên vô cùng đơn giản.
  2. Nhu cầu công việc cao: Sự phát triển của Rubi đã tạo nên nhu cầu tuyển dụng developer Ruby ngày càng tăng cao trên thị trường lao động.
  3. Hệ sinh thái phong phú: Rubi có một hệ sinh thái rộng lớn với nhiều thư viện hữu ích, giúp tăng hiệu suất và tiết kiệm thời gian trong quá trình phát triển ứng dụng.
  4. Linh hoạt kết nối cơ sở dữ liệu: Ruby dễ dàng kết nối với nhiều hệ quản trị cơ sở dữ liệu như DB2, MySQL, Oracle, và Sybase.
  5. Hỗ trợ viết thư viện bên ngoài: Bạn có thể thực hiện viết thư viện bên ngoài bằng Rubi hoặc bằng C, tăng tính linh hoạt và hiệu năng của ứng dụng.
  6. Tính bảo mật cao: Ruby được đánh giá cao về tính bảo mật, giúp bảo vệ ứng dụng khỏi các lỗ hổng bảo mật tiềm tàng.
  7. Cú pháp linh hoạt: Cú pháp của Rubi ngày càng trở nên linh hoạt và dễ dàng để developer thực hiện các tác vụ phức tạp.
  8. Xử lý chuỗi mạnh mẽ: Ruby có hệ thống chuỗi xử lý mạnh mẽ, giúp xử lý dữ liệu dễ dàng và hiệu quả.
  9. Trình gỡ lỗi tiện lợi: Rubi hỗ trợ trình gỡ lỗi lớn, giúp bạn dễ dàng phát hiện và sửa lỗi trong quá trình phát triển.
  10. Đa nền tảng: developer Ruby có thể hoạt động trên nhiều nền tảng khác nhau, giúp tối ưu hóa quy trình phát triển.

Nhược Điểm Tồn Tại

  1. Khó khăn trong cài đặt môi trường: Mặc dù sử dụng Rubi đơn giản, việc cài đặt môi trường để học Ruby có thể gặp phải khó khăn.
  2. Tốc độ xử lý chậm: So với một số ngôn ngữ lập trình khác, Rubi có thời gian xử lý chậm hơn, đòi hỏi tối ưu hóa mã nguồn để tăng hiệu suất.

Lý Do Nên Học Ngôn Ngữ Lập Trình Ruby Ngay Hôm Nay

Khám Phá Tính Năng Hấp Dẫn Của Ruby

Cùng ITNavi khám phá những lý do nên học ngôn ngữ Rubi ngay hôm nay, để hiểu vì sao ngôn ngữ này được ưa chuộng và tạo nên nhiều cơ hội việc làm hấp dẫn.

1. Đơn giản và Dễ Học

Ruby là một ngôn ngữ lập trình cấp cao, với tính trực tượng mạnh mẽ, giúp người mới bắt đầu dễ dàng sử dụng và hiểu.

2. Bước Đệm Cho Rubi on Rails

Ruby on Rails là một trong những Framework phổ biến nhất và phụ thuộc mạnh mẽ vào Ruby. Học Rubi sẽ giúp bạn tiếp cận và làm chủ Rails một cách dễ dàng.

3. Tăng Cơ Hội Việc Làm

Ngành nghề developer Ruby đang được nhiều doanh nghiệp săn đón, mở ra nhiều cơ hội việc làm hấp dẫn trong lĩnh vực công nghệ.

Học ngôn ngữ lập trình Rubi sẽ mở ra cánh cửa đến một thế giới lập trình đầy thú vị và tiềm năng không giới hạn. Với sự đơn giản và linh hoạt của Ruby, bạn sẽ dễ dàng tiếp cận và nắm vững kiến thức lập trình.

Sử dụng Ruby, bạn có thể tạo ra các ứng dụng web động mạnh mẽ và kết hợp với các framework phổ biến. Khả năng lập trình hướng đối tượng của Ruby giúp xây dựng mã nguồn dễ bảo trì và mở rộng. Bạn có thể tự tin giải quyết các vấn đề phức tạp trong quá trình phát triển.

Dễ học, mạnh mẽ và linh hoạt, Rubi là lựa chọn tuyệt vời cho sự khởi đầu hoặc nâng cao sự nghiệp lập trình của bạn. Hãy bắt đầu học ngay và khám phá sức mạnh lập trình mà Rubi mang lại!

Trương Thành Tài
0
    0
    Đơn hàng
    Đơn hàng trốngQuay lại Shop